When did Britain and France adopt a policy of appeasment toward Germany?

in the 1930's. first hints of it were with Manchuria in 1931 when Britain and the League of Nations failed to reprehend Japan for their actions. Neville Chamberlain came to power in 1937 and he is the British Prime Minister famously associated with this form of foreign policy.

What were the responses of Great Britain and France to Hitler's early actions in world war 2?

German troops invaded Poland on September 1 1939. On September 3, Britain and France responded by declaring war on Germany.

Why did Britain go to war over Poland in 1939?

Britain and France both had a defence agreement with Poland. When Germany attacked Poland on 1st September 1939, Britain and France both declared war on Germany two days later but their actions did absolutely nothing to help Poland.
